Integrated Risk Management (IRM) develops, implements, and maintains the framework for managing risk across Munich Re’s US P&C operations. Our mission is to ensure that these risks are well understood and managed effectively through a variety of quantitative and qualitative processes.
Within IRM, our regional Risk Analytics & Strategy team quantifies the risks faced by the US P&C companies using our internal economic capital model and scenario analyses. We provide senior management with an internal view of our companies’ risk profile, which is used to support the capital management and corporate risk transfer decisions of our companies.
In addition, our team facilitates the development and maintenance of each company's Risk Strategy, a process that involves quantifying our risk appetite through a series of risk criteria. We regularly report on these criteria and the resulting strategies to senior management, the Board, and regulators. Beyond this, our team provides second line risk opinions to the Board or risk committee on an ad-hoc basis. This often includes the analysis of large deals and the discussion of new or emerging risk topics.

Responsibilities:
Key responsibilities of this position include:
- Capital Modeling and Risk Analytics: Lead recurring projects in risk capital modeling, portfolio analysis, stress testing, and scenario analysis. Leverage data and expertise from across the organization to assess risk exposures and inform capital management, reinsurance, and other strategic business decisions.
- Risk Governance, Assessment, and Reporting: Lead or support enterprise risk management processes, including the annual Own Risk and Solvency Assessment (ORSA), Risk Strategy, risk assessments, and risk reporting. Partner with business leaders and executive management to evaluate risks, assess management actions, and support risk-informed decision making.
- Model Development, Validation, and Enhancement: Drive the continued development of the internal economic capital model to improve the identification, measurement, and aggregation of risks, including emerging risks such as cyber, climate, and wildfire. Independently or collaboratively perform model validation activities and evaluate methodologies, assumptions, and implementation against industry standards and best practices.
- Risk Advisory and Decision Support: Provide risk and capital expertise to business and executive stakeholders through analysis, presentations, training, and consultation. Translate complex quantitative concepts into actionable insights that support strategic planning, risk management, and business decision making.
